Output 7828fa9bc828953a23cb6890817ea6d16565f30cd5fb9b9bd10c5cc86075c62d:4

value
16584010
script pubkey
OP_0 OP_PUSHBYTES_20 2d1853fcea6fc0e5900500f0b06f8d94d7a4a50e
address
bc1q95v98l82dlqwtyq9qrctqmudjnt6ffgw3ty89q
transaction
7828fa9bc828953a23cb6890817ea6d16565f30cd5fb9b9bd10c5cc86075c62d
spent
true